Design a class Mailbox that stores e-mail messages, using the Message class of Lab 5.1. Implement the following methods:

• public void addMessage(Message m)
• public int getNumberOfMessages()
• public Message getMessage(int position)
• public void removeMessage(int position)


Copy the highlighted code below to your main method (replace code from Lab 5.1) to test your Mailbox class:

Explanation / Answer

please find the code

mailbox class

import java.util.ArrayList;

public class Mailbox {

ArrayList<Message> mailbox;

public Mailbox(){

mailbox = new ArrayList<Message>();

}

public void addMessage(Message m) {

mailbox.add(m);

}

public int getNumberOfMessages() {

return mailbox.size();

}

public Message getMessage(int position) {

return mailbox.get(position);

}

public void removeMessage(int position) {

mailbox.remove(position);

}

}
